Grandin, New Jersey
Populated place in Hunterdon County, New Jersey, US
Unincorporated community in New Jersey, United States
40°37′03″N 74°56′02″W / 40.61750°N 74.93389°W / 40.61750; -74.93389[1]
Grandin is an unincorporated community located along the border of Franklin and Union townships in Hunterdon County, New Jersey, United States.[2]
The Bethlehem United Presbyterian Church, also known as the Grandin Church, is a contributing property of the Rockhill Agricultural Historic District, listed on the National Register of Historic Places.[3]
The Norfolk Southern Railway's Lehigh Line (formerly the mainline of the Lehigh Valley Railroad), runs through the community.[citation needed]
